Amway is an American company that sells health, beauty, and home care products worldwide through a network of distributors. Founded in 1959, it is the largest MLM company by revenue and has faced allegations of pyramid scheme practices in several countries.

ACN Inc. is a North American multi-level marketing (MLM) company that offers various services, such as landline, wireless, broadband, energy, and merchant services. It operates in 27 countries and has been involved in legal cases and controversies, including a class action lawsuit against Donald Trump and his family.
